Hi , i have got a problem in my environment, The SQL server Agent errror logs is continously filled up with below error messages "[298] SQLServer Error: 14262, The specified @job_id ('74AF9B09-0C54-449E-8BDC-3D323D570D1F') does not exist. [SQLSTATE 42000] (ConnExecuteCachableOp" After several research, i got to know that EXEC sp_delete_job @job_id='74AF9B09-0C54-449E-8BDC-3D323D570D1F' statement is running contionously at background , which is making these error messagges entries. I even restarted the SQL Agent https://connect.microsoft.com/SQLServer/feedback/details/644099/collection-job-collection-set-1-noncached-collect-and-upload-failing-sometimes service , but still not helped. Please guide me in resolving this problem. thanks in advance. Mar 20 '12 #1 Post Reply Share this Question 2 Replies Expert 2.5K+ P: 2,878 ck9663 You might want to check first why there's a delete job running. If you are certain that it is not needed, disable that job first and see what happens.
